Output 19985cdcdefac73c6544b82a850db69ad3d217eea380f7d9faeb71edb24bf11e:0

value
1088735
script pubkey
OP_0 OP_PUSHBYTES_20 d8dbfc4181f7740493e911bab09c1d3cb5f3b18a
address
bc1qmrdlcsvp7a6qfylfzxatp8qa8j6l8vv267lm7m
transaction
19985cdcdefac73c6544b82a850db69ad3d217eea380f7d9faeb71edb24bf11e
confirmations
173858
spent
true